Member of the Bundestag Kati Engel leaves the Left Party

Engel has been sitting in the Landtag for the Left Party for about ten years. Now she is turning her back to the party - due to investigations against a fellow member.

After more than 20 years - Member of the Bundestag Kati Engel leaves the Left Party

Just days before the September 1st state election, Left Party state MP Kati Engel has resigned from the party. A spokesperson for the state branch confirmed that Engel had declared her resignation via email. On Facebook, the 42-year-old from West Thuringia wrote that she had decided to take this step in connection with investigations into suspicions of possession of child pornographic material against another Left Party MP.

"Today, after over twenty years, I have declared my immediate resignation from the Left Party," Engel wrote in a post. "As a children's politician, I find it unacceptable how the party is handling accusations of child pornography within its own ranks," she criticized, among other things, that the suspected MP had not been asked to resign his current state parliament mandate.

The investigations were a shock for the party. Following the lifting of immunity, the state parliament office of the MP in question was searched on Tuesday. According to earlier statements by Left Party faction leader Steffen Dittes, the man had announced that he would suspend all his positions in the party and faction. This also applies to his activities in the state election campaign.

Many representatives of the Left had reacted shocked to the accusations. If the accusations are true, he expects severe consequences, Minister President Bodo Ramelow wrote on X. "It must be clarified quickly, comprehensively, and consistently." Dittes and the party leadership offered police and the public prosecutor's office any support.

Engel was the children and youth political spokesperson in the faction. The 42-year-old joined the predecessor party of the Left, the PDS, in 2003, and has been in the state parliament since 2014. She will not be running for the upcoming state election.

Engel announced that she would not participate in the upcoming state election due to her resignation. The search at the state parliament office of the suspected MP was conducted after Engel's revelation about the child pornography suspicions.
